How Can a conveyancing solicitor near me Help?
A conveyancing solicitor plays a crucial role in the buying or selling of a property. They are responsible for handling all the legal aspects of the transaction, including conducting property searches, reviewing contracts, and ensuring that all necessary paperwork is in order. Here are some ways in which a conveyancing solicitor near you can help:
1. Conducting property searches: Your conveyancing solicitor will conduct searches on the property you are buying to check for any issues that may affect its value or your ownership rights. These searches may include checking for planning permissions, environmental concerns, or boundary disputes.
2. Reviewing contracts: Your conveyancing solicitor will carefully review the sale contract or purchase agreement to ensure that all terms are fair and legally binding. They will also negotiate any changes that may be necessary to protect your interests.
3. Handling exchange and completion: Your conveyancing solicitor will manage the exchange of contracts and the completion of the transaction on your behalf. They will ensure that all necessary funds are transferred, and that keys are exchanged at the agreed-upon time.
4. Dealing with legal paperwork: Throughout the conveyancing process, your solicitor will handle all the necessary legal paperwork, including the transfer of ownership and registration of the property with the Land Registry.
